Problems solved by technology

[0003] The structure of the garbage sorting device in the prior art is relatively simple, and most of them are simple garbage can structures, and different garbage collection areas are arranged in the garbage cans. However, the amount of garbage that can be accommodated by such conventional simple garbage cans is relatively small, especially When recycling some folding boxes, plastic water bottles and other garbage, due to their large size, the garbage that can be accommodated in the garbage bin is very limited

Abstract

The present invention relates to the technical field of garbage sorting equipment, and more specifically, relates to a garbage sorting device, including a garbage compression box, a garbage compression mechanism, a driving mechanism, a drop gate mechanism, a liquid garbage collection mechanism, and a solid garbage collection box. The garbage compression box and the solid garbage collection box are fixedly connected and communicated from top to bottom; the upper end of the garbage compression box is connected with a garbage compression mechanism, and the lower end of the garbage compression box is connected with a drop door mechanism; the driving mechanism It is fixedly connected to the garbage compression box; the driving mechanism is intermittently connected to the garbage compression mechanism and the drop door mechanism; the outer end of the drop door mechanism is fixedly connected to and communicated with the liquid garbage collection mechanism. There is a garbage compression mechanism inside the invention, which can properly compress the garbage that needs to be put into the inside of the invention, reduce the volume of garbage, and thus increase the garbage capacity of the invention to a certain extent.
